نتایج جستجو برای: fault tolerance

تعداد نتایج: 176292  

2007
Keith Scott

In this paper. we review the two existing methods of producing fault-tolerant software and the;r associated reliability models. A new approach to software fault-tolerance, the Consensus Recovery Block, is proposed. Its reliability model 1S used to demonstrate its superiority over the conventional methods.

2004
Fred B. Schneider Lidong Zhou

Fault-tolerance and attack-tolerance are crucial for implementing a trustworthy service. An emerging thread of research investigates interactions between fault-tolerance and attack-tolerance—specifically, the coupling of replication with threshold cryptography for use in environments satisfying weak assumptions. This coupling yields a new paradigm known as distributed trust, which is the subjec...

2008
Byung-Gon Chun Petros Maniatis Scott Shenker John Kubiatowicz

Long-term services that operate reliably are hard to construct. In this paper, we argue that for long-term services we need a stronger service property called Healthy-WriteImplies-Correct-Read (HWICR): once a value is written in a healthy period (i.e., when the system’s fault assumption is not violated), the value is correctly read despite intervening unhealthy periods. To build services with t...

2010
Huan-yu Tu

Fault tolerance has always been a critical feature for reliable electronic systems. As the systems are becoming more and more complex, novel approaches inspired from bio-system have become an interested research field. Biological systems possessed characteristics such as self-healing and self-reproduction that are similar to the requirement of fault tolerance design. This paper investigates and...

Journal: :IEEE Trans. Software Eng. 1995
Anish Arora Sandeep S. Kulkarni

Masking fault-tolerance guarantees that programs continually satisfy their specii-cation in the presence of faults. By way of contrast, nonmasking fault-tolerance does not guarantee as much: it merely guarantees that when faults stop occurring, program executions converge to states from where programs continually (re)satisfy their speciication. We present in this paper a component based method ...

2013
Jyoti chaudhary

Grid computing is a distributed computing model that provides access to the geographically distributed heterogeneous resources. These computational grid systems are highly unreliable in nature because of which they need fault tolerance to be an integral part of the system to increase reliability. Commonly utilized techniques for providing fault tolerance are discussed. This paper provides state...

Journal: :CoRR 2018
Ittai Abraham Guy Golan-Gueta Dahlia Malkhi Jean-Philippe Martin

In a previous note [1], we observed a safety violation in Zyzzyva [7, 9, 8] and a liveness violation in FaB [12, 13]. In this manuscript, we sketch fixes to both. The same view-change core is applied in the two schemes, and additionally, applied to combine them and create a single, enhanced scheme that has the benefits of both approaches.

Journal: :CoRR 2017
Ittai Abraham Guy Golan-Gueta Dahlia Malkhi Lorenzo Alvisi Ramakrishna Kotla Jean-Philippe Martin

In this note, we observe a safety violation in Zyzzyva [7, 9, 8] and a liveness violation in FaB [14, 15]. To demonstrate these issues, we require relatively simple scenarios, involving only four replicas, and one or two view changes. In all of them, the problem is manifested already in the first log slot.

2003
Paolo Ballarini Lorenzo Capra Giuliana Franceschinis Massimiliano De Pierro

This paper presents a case study of a software fault tolerance mechanisms, the distributed memory, designed and implemented within the european projects TIRAN and DEPAUDE, and currently under study within the Italian project ISIDE. The studied mechanisms are part of a complete framework of general purpose software fault tolerance mechanisms. In this paper we show a method for the compositional ...

نمودار تعداد نتایج جستجو در هر سال

با کلیک روی نمودار نتایج را به سال انتشار فیلتر کنید